"De högt hängande frukterna" : En studie av koldioxidskattens inverkan på skogsindustrin / "The high-hanging fruits” : A study on the impact of carbon dioxide tax in the forest industry

Rosquist, Mattias January 2017 (has links)
The aim of this bachelor thesis is to investige how Swedish companies in the pulp- and paper industry are affected by the CO2 tax and how their perceived effects differs from the actual effects. The work includes interviews with employer representatives from six different companies. The respondents have been chosen based on their position in the company. Furthermore a pilot study was conducted with two interviews leading the study to the right direction. One of them was a tax expert at Skatteverket and the other one was an Energy Director at Skogsindustrierna. The questions asked were for example: “How do you work with sustainability issues”, “are your business affected by any special environmental taxes” and “what do you think about existing environmental regulations”. One of the conclusions turned out to be, that all of the companies are well informed about the sustainability issues. Most of the companies are also working with these issues on a high strategic level. Only one company thought that the Swedish taxation law affected their competitiveness. Another conclusion is that there is almost no complaints about different taxes and especially not the CO2 tax. One company complained however about the tax on NOx. Sustainable Energy Carrier Investments : A case study on the drywall manufacturing industry

Hallberg, Kevin, Sandström, Kevin January 2022 (has links)
Background According to the United Nations, climate change is one of the most challenging and urgent problems. To reduce emissions, various regulations have been introduced. Emissions trading (EU-ETS) and carbon dioxide tax are two economic instruments aimed at reducing greenhouse gas emissions. The industrial sector in Sweden today accounts for 31% of carbon dioxide emissions, and a common fossil energy carrier used is liquified petroleum gas (LPG). When LPG is burned, carbon dioxide is produced, contributing to climate change. By replacing LPG with a sustainable energy carrier, industries can reduce costs associated with emissions and thus increase competitiveness while lowering environmental impact. Therefore, there is a need for a framework that deals with both the economic and environmental impact that arises if alternative sustainable energy carriers replace LPG. Objectives The study’s objective is to evaluate alternative energy carriers that can phase out the use of LPG. The contribution of this study is a framework that analyzes and visualizes the economic and sustainable benefits of changing energy carriers. Methods A techno-economic model was developed by evaluating economic and sustainable indicators. A case study was conducted on a company that uses LPG in its manufacturing process. Eight different scenarios were set up where various energy carriers are used. Data concerning the different scenarios were collected. The scenarios were compared and analyzed based on the model to see which alternative energy carriers generate economic and sustainable improvements. Results The results from the case study show that all scenarios had an increased environmental performance compared to LPG. Either by reduced CO2 emissions or by being carbon dioxide neutral. From an economic perspective, only one scenario is more favorable than LPG, Bio- LPG. Bio-LPG reduces the total cost by 28.5%. Conclusions The study presents a model that can evaluate alternative energy carriers from an economic and environmental perspective. In many cases, a trade-off was discovered either being sustainable at a high cost or paying fees for emissions at a lower price. Alternative energy carriers exist with less environmental impact. Still, the technology for many of them is not sufficiently developed for large-scale production and use, which means that the cost is too high. Energy Policies and Directed Technical Change : How Governments Incentivize Firms to Invests in Renewable Energy innovation / Energipolitik och riktad teknologisk utveckling : Hur Regeringar ger incitament till företag att investera i förnyelsebar energi-innovation

Roberts, Christopher January 2019 (has links)
Policies are regarded as the most important instrument in redirecting invention Policies are regarded as the most important instrument in redirecting invention investments away from fossil fuel technologies towards renewable energy technologies. Despite the importance and urgency in decarbonizing the economy, the literature on how different energy policies effect the development of renewable energy technologies is relatively scarce. A difficulty has been in justifying the operationalizing of policies in as both valid and reliable. This thesis tackles the operationalization difficulty and produces empirical evidence in how effective various policies are in incentivizing the development of renewable energy technologies (RET). The main findings are that government R&D expenditure increases firm innovation across all RET, demand-pull policies either increase the likelihood of firm inventions or has an insignificant effect and carbon taxation does not increase the likelihood of RET invention. / Politiska instrument är ansedda som de medel som kan ha störst inverkan att omdirigera innovation investeringar från fossila till förnyelsebara energier. Reducing Swedish Carbon Dioxide Emissions from the Basic Industry and Energy Utilities : An Actor and Policy Analysis

Stigson, Peter January 2007 (has links)
The aim of the thesis is to analyze the design of the present climate and energy policies. The main focus is on how the policy instruments affect the Swedish stakeholders who are included in the European Union’s Emission Trading Scheme (EU-ETS). In-depth interviews have been carried out with representatives from the basic industry, energy utilities as well as industrial and green organizations. The purpose is to illustrate have how these stakeholders view the current policy framework and what amendments that they view as necessary. Suggestions to the Government are given regarding the design of national policies and policy instruments to provide for an improved policy framework. The information and synthesis have furthermore been collected through extensive literature studies as well as participating at conferences and seminars. The thesis is written as a monograph in order to address a larger group of readers interested in the transition of energy systems towards sustainability as well as policy makers and Swedish stakeholders. The common understanding that the global energy systems have to undergo a transition to renewables and higher energy efficiency due to the earth’s finite sources of fossil fuels and uranium presents large challenges for policy makers and business sectors as well as the society in general. Global greenhouse gas (GHG) emissions have to be drastically reduced and the work to achieve this has started through international negotiations such as the Kyoto Protocol. As the present commitment levels are low, an important issue in a short-term perspective is to develop a more comprehensive and efficient system with a much wider participation and more stringent emission targets. In order to achieve current national policy goals and international GHG emission commitments the Swedish Government utilizes a number of policy instruments that are either nationally self-assumed or called for by international agreements or the European Union. The Swedish stakeholders that are included in the EU-ETS face a broad policy framework that has a large impact on their daily operations and future investment strategies. It is imperative for the policymakers, i.e. the Government, to act in accordance with the long-term perspective that the climate change issue and the transition of the energy system require. It is likewise important that any actions are in accordance with the operational and investment climate that the business sector faces. It is argued that these aspects are not fully considered as the success of the next national budget or term of public office seems to overshadow these issues. A long-term perspective is required to provide the business sector with stable and reliable incentives. This is needed to provide the economic conditions under which the businesses can realize investments that will result in emission reductions. Short-term policies reinforce the view of environmental investments as a form of risk investments. This negatively affects the possibility of the policy instruments to effectively achieve established policy goals. Paying attention to these requirements is however not a simple task for policy makers as it will require agreements between the political parties. This demonstrates the main political difficulty with climate change – the requirement of a long-term and full commitment by all state authorities. It should be noted that the thesis does not attempt to describe the Swedish policy makers as neglecting the urgency of acting to mitigate climate change. The national agenda is far to advanced from an international perspective for such statements. The thesis however pinpoints some important issues highlighted by stakeholders, within the business sector and other organizations, who are concerned with the present climate and energy policy framework. Some of the findings are as follows: • Reducing GHG emissions in order to combat climate change must include a long-term perspective • The design of policy instruments should consequently be long-term to increase the support for investments in GHG emission reducing technologies • The design of policies that promote low GHG production alternatives within the energy utilities should be improved • The large potential for reduced GHG emission available through fuel switching and energy efficiency improvements in the Swedish basic industry should be promoted by amended policies • Reformulate or abandon the national GHG emissions target goal with the current formulation • Strive for an emission rights allocation system that is as transparent, fair and predictable as possible • The policy framework should aim for a high level of stability through interaction with the affected stakeholders • These factors are inherently important for the overall efficiency of the policy framework
